For Windows® Me
Start Windows® Me
1 .
2 .
Click on the 'Start' button, point to 'Settings', and then click on 'Control Panel'.
3 .
Double click on the 'Display' Icon.
4 .
Select the 'Settings' tab then click on 'Advanced...'.
5 .
Select the 'Monitor' button, then click on 'Change...' button.
6 .
Select 'Specify the location of the driver(Advanced)' and click on the 'Next' button.
7 .
Select 'Display a list of all the drivers in a specific location, so you can choose the driver you want', then click
on 'Next' and then click on 'Have Disk...'.
8 .
Click on the 'Browse...' button, select the appropriate drive F: ( CD-ROM Drive) then click on the 'OK' button.
9 .
Click on the 'OK' button, select your monitor model and click on the 'Next' button.
1 0 .
Click on 'Finish' button then the 'Close' button.
For Windows® XP
Start Windows® XP
1 .
2 .
Click on the 'Start' button and then click on 'Control Panel'.
3 .
Select and click on the category 'Printers and Other Hardware'
4 .
Click on the 'Display' Item.
5 .
Select the 'Settings' tab then click on the 'Advanced' button.
6 .
Select 'Monitor' tab
- If the 'Properties' button is inactive, it means your monitor is properly configured. Please stop installation.
- If the 'Properties' button is active, click on 'Properties' button.
Please follow the steps below.
7 .
Click on the 'Driver' tab and then click on 'Update Driver...' button.
8 .
Select the 'Install from a list or specific location [advanced]' radio button and then click on the 'Next' button.
9 .
Select the 'Don't Search. I will choose the driver to install' radio button. Then click on the 'Next' button.
1 0 .
Click on the 'Have disk...' button, then click on the 'Browse...' button and then select the appropriate drive F:
(CD-ROM Drive).
1 1 .
Click on the 'Open' button, then click the 'OK' button.
1 2 .
Select your monitor model and click on the 'Next' button.
- If you can see the 'has not passed Windows® Logo testing to verify its compatibility with Windows® XP'
message, please click on the 'Continue Anyway' button.
1 3 .
Click on the 'Finish' button then the 'Close' button.
1 4 .
Click on the 'OK' button and then the 'OK' button again to close the Display_Properties dialog box.
